| HIST | Joyce B. Huggins BISHOPVILLE — Joyce Branham Huggins, 78, widow of C.W. Huggins, died Monday, March 4, 2013, at Carolina Pines Regional Medical Center in Hartsville. Born in Kershaw County, she was a daughter of the late Alex and Eva Ray Branham. Mrs. Huggins was a member of St. Andrew Church of God. She was the former owner and operator of the Sharecropper and Huggy Bear restaurants. Survivors include a son, Chuck Atkinson (Leann Threatt); two granddaughters, Jennifer Carter (Randy) and Hope Rowell (Jake); a grandson, Charlie Atkinson (Jennifer Jones); five great-grandchildren; three stepsons, Dale Anthony Huggins, Charles W. Huggins and Edward Huggins; a stepdaughter, Kay Matthews; 10 step-grandchildren; 20 step-great-grandchildren; and a brother, Murdick Branham. She was preceded in death by her first husband, Claude Atkinson; five brothers; and five sisters. Funeral services will be held at 3 p.m. Thursday at St. Andrew Church of God with the Rev. Dr. Frank Ramey officiating. Burial will be in the church cemetery. The family will receive friends from 6 to 8 p.m. today at Hancock-Elmore-Hill Funeral Home and other times at 2715 Red Hill Road, Bishopville. Hancock-Elmore-Hill Funeral Home of Bishopville is in charge of the arrangements. Posted in Obituaries on Wednesday, March 6, 2013 [3] | |
